Cadw's description

On rising ground at the top of the road; detached between the former National School and the former Siloam Baptist Chapel.

Mid C19 (after ca 1845).

Simple classical 2-storey, 3-window roughcast front with end pilaster strips, cill band and plinth. Hipped slate roof, boxed eaves, brick chimney stacks. 12-pane sash windows to first floor with scroll lugged architraves and ornamental keystones; 16-pane ground floor sash windows set in segmental arched recesses. Central pedimented doorcase with recessed 8-panel door and 5-pane fanlight.

Barley twist cast-iron railings with finials to small front terrace with gate of same style.
